Try This: Try to make your own..Bangle! Its fun to try things..which personally reflect your style. Cuffs or big bangle are really cool and must-have accessory of the season. So in the DIY activity of the month. The Demeanor suggests Cuffs in Try It section, its going to fun when your signature touch and personalized color wheel on the bangles. Budget: Rs.30 to 40. 30 to 40. You can make it more expensive by adding your favorite blings or stick ons. Style 1: Wrap my maniac Things you need: 1. A wooden or plastic bangle ( You can reuse your faux pas bangle or you can buy from street vendor for Rs10-20) 2. Bright colored thread or wool (thread can be crochet thread) 3. Round bell (in Indian ghoongru) Method: Bunch all the colors of thread together. Hold you bangle and tie an end of the thread bunch on it. Start wrapping easily. If want to the Indian touch to it, you can add ghoongru in the thread that you are wrapping. And you are done.. Style 2: Simply Paint love Things you need: 1. A wooden or plastic bangle 2. Bright Acrylic colors and paint brushes Method: Paint a base color on your bangle. Show your wide (and wild) imagination in creating cool stuff on you bangle. Leave it to dry. To give a glossy look, you can polish it with varnish and leave it to dry for 24 hours. Gosh! You gonna be proud of your creativity! Style 3: Love my Denim Things you need: 1.A wooden or plastic bangle 2. Worn out or torn out piece of jeans 3. Glue Method: Cut the denim in a long strip. Apply glue globally, inside and outside of the bangle. Start wrapping the bangle. Make sure you do it neatly, even if you want ruff-tuff look. Your bangle ready to cuff the attentions of fashion elites to be like you.
